#TheVanity Tip #4: Leave-In Conditioner
This type of product cuts out the time consuming task of washing/ wetting your hair daily. I personally do not like to wash my hair daily because it strips the hair of its natural oils; and I’ve become fond of how big my curls get as days pass :) If you have color treated hair, its extremely important to make sure your hair stays hydrated and moisturized especially if your color of choice is black or blonde as those are the 2 most damaging dyes. Now I've searched for “curl refreshing” products but oddly enough, those labeled as such turned out to be too thick and sticky (in my opinion). The leave-in conditioner made more sense seeing as how we condition our hair when we wash it plus I was able to use it on the occasion that I did press my hair as well. After a steamy shower I spray the product in abundance all over my curls, taking special care to the middle of my hair where its the shortest and more of a fro with less curls; this process cuts the time down it takes to get ready.
MYTH: going natural doesn't need as much maintenance- this is FALSE. Just because you don't apply heat or chemicals to your hair does not mean that you can just get up and go. While you don't have to spend 30min to an hour on your hair does not mean that you don't have to make sure that your hair is still getting the nutrients it needs to flourish. Not only that, most of us, our hair doesn't keep the same shape after bed. I have one side that loses its curl when I sleep even if I sleep on the other side- the leave-in gives life to the straight and frizzy pieces.
Now, on to what people think matters most: the brand. I’ve done some experimenting with different brands, focusing on those that are made with some kind of oil (coconut, mango, olive, etc.). My results ended up the same, hydration and poppin! One brand that I will say that stands out to me though is the Jamaican Mango & Lime “Pure Naturals” line (not pictured, not yet in stores). This line was created for natural hair and if you have ever used any of the original products you’ll agree that its worth a try. I had the pleasure of being a demonstration model for this line at a previous hair show. The first day after my hair was washed and conditioned with the product line, the only product used was the Pure Naturals leave-in. Amazingly enough, the 3rd day I did not have to apply the product again! My hair was so soft, not dry & brittle which is what usually prompts me to have to condition daily. Overall my goal was to find something that would help get me ready for the day on the fly. The look picture above was easy to manage even after taking my hair out of the “pineapple” protective style. An apple a day🍏... So I'm not really an apple person (especially red ones) but I will occasionally indulge in a green or yellow one with peanut butter 😋. But recently I've begun to eat them more frequently for one reason: fiber. I definitely don't get enough fiber in my diet and it takes a toll on my body in complicated ways. I don't really care for supplements if I can get what I need from fresh foods so I'm challenging myself to eat one apple a day for a 'minimum' of 1 week. I want to be able to feel the changes in the way my body digests and gets rid of the waste that I don't need. Other fruits good in fiber: bananas, oranges, mangoes, strawberries, raspberries as well as veggies- the darker the veggie, the higher the fiber content, whole grains and beans & legumes.

#TheVanity Tip #2: Secrets in a Bottle: Jamaican Mango & Lime Black Castor Oil with Rosemary🌿
Castor oil has many uses including a remedy to several ailments (I wouldn't recommend this beauty supply brand for treatments- something more natural and sold in organic markets), aromatherapy & hair. When I first started using it I found that it was what I considered too thick for my hair but I was slightly more relaxed when using it while I soaked. Then something really weird happened. . . After washing my face, I paid attention my eyebrows. There was a patch missing😳, like I had scratched the hair off (and I had been scratching them lately, so who knows) and the rest of the brow was lighter in some places- my hair was slightly thinning. Now I've been blessed with natural arches and demi thick brows so I'm very sensitive and particular about what happens with them. Freaking out because I looked like a leopard, my mom told me about this gem💎 I applied it with a q tip before bed and (because I was on a mission) even during the day. After about a week or so of use, my brows were werewolf status. They had gotten so thick & you couldn't tell that hair had ever been missing! I got so excited because now I had an easy fix should anything go left with my prized possessions- twice at this point. It keeps me from having to use make up to fill them in on the regular. I've also applied it to my lashes before bed because I have a habit of pulling them out unconsciously and the results were same- lashes plentiful and a little curly. I'll probably give it another shot using it in my hair but just starting with the scalp and roots then moving throughout😌
